For Torres, the games do not last 90 minutes


Given Saudi Arabia Fernando Torres became the sixth player to reach 100 games for the club in Spain after Zubizarreta, Casillas, Xavi, Xabi Alonso and Raul. Sometimes questioned and idolized as the author of decisive goals like the final of Euro 2008 at the Ernst Happel, the truth is that Fuenlabrada striker entered in capital letters in the history of the Spanish national team. But there is a striking fact that this centenary Chelsea striker because of those hundred encounters, only 19 of them completed the full 90 minutes, being therefore substitute or substituted during the clash on 82 occasions. The last of them, more than three years ago, in the semifinals of the Confederations Cup against the United States. If we add up the minutes played by the boy since his arrival in the national team in 2004, the figure is 5504 minutes, with the average in 100 games just over 55 minutes per game. Remember that Fernando Torres, despite being instrumental in winning the European Championship in 2008, it was undisputed or the South African World Cup, where accompanied Villa players like Silva or Peter, or the last European Championship in Poland and Ukraine , where the strategy of 'false 9' away to Madrid of ownership in favor of Cesc Fabregas.
